NVIDIA BioNeMo Inference Runtime enters public beta, speeding protein structure prediction on GPUs
AllThingsApx · x · 2026-09-13
NVIDIA announced the public beta of BioNeMo Inference Runtime, an open, PyTorch-native library that accelerates biomolecular inference on NVIDIA GPUs. It supports optimizing models like Boltz-2, OpenFold2, and Protenix v2 with specialized kernels and CUDA Graphs, scaling via Ray-powered GPU replicas, with collaborators including apheris, SandboxAQ, and Xaira Therapeutics. The post also quotes a joke benchmarking a 166K-parameter fruit fly protein model against AlphaFold.
